In order to solve the puzzle, you’ll need to do both home work and field work. Your home work consists of determining the values for four keys, A, B, C and D. You’ll use those keys to unlock the location for your field work, where you’ll determine the values for three more keys, E, F and G. All seven values will then be used to determine the final location.

Part 1: The Trip to the Old Spooky Mansion

 

Scooby Doo, Norville “Shaggy” Rogers, Fred Jones, Daphne Blake, Velma Dinkley and Scooby’s nephew Scrappy Doo were investigating the mystery of the old spooky mansion. They decided that in order to be successful, they would need to stay the night, so they gathered some necessary supplies. Each of the six crime-solvers brought a different Scooby Snack and piece of equipment. They agreed to ride to the mansion in the Mystery Wagon together, but they each arrived at the wagon at a different time between 10:30 pm and 12 midnight.

 

  • In order of arrival were (1) the canine who brought Twinkies; (2) a male human crime-solver; (3) the crime-solver who brought a mask; (4) Daphne; (5) the woman who brought invisible ink; and (6) the crime-solver who brought a calculator.

  • Neither of the dogs brought Ding Dongs.

  • The woman who brought the magnifying glass arrived exactly one hour after the crime-solver who brought Ho-Hos but not the UV light.

  • One of the women brought cupcakes.

  • The Zebra Brownies, which were brought by a woman, did not arrive at the same time as the magnifying glass, which arrived later than Scooby did.

  • The invisible ink arrived after the cupcakes but before the Sno-Balls.

  • The 2 dogs arrived first and last.

  • Shaggy, surprisingly, does not care for Ho-Hos and would never bring them to share.

Part 3: Seance at the Old Spooky Mansion

The six members of the crime-solving team decided to hold a seance to help discover the secret of the old spooky mansion. Based on the following statements, determine the location of the group members around the table. (Orientation clues assume that all team members are facing the table, Roman numeral ”I” is located furthest north, and that clockwise is as viewed from above, as pictured.)

  • The tallest member of the team is sitting directly across the table from the shortest member of the team. This tallest member is further north than the shortest member.

  • The two women are seated next to each other; the shorter of the two women has the taller woman to her left and the shortest member of the team to her right.

  • The group members at Roman numerals IV & V do not wear eyeglasses.

  • The two dogs are not next to each other.
